Forecast: Re-Import of Not Knitted or Crocheted Women's and Girls' Trousers and Shorts of Cotton to France

The re-import of non-knitted or crocheted women's and girls' trousers and shorts of cotton to France is projected to increase steadily from 2024 to 2028, with values rising from 7.1153 million USD to 7.319 million USD. Assuming a constant growth rate from recent years, the year-on-year growth rate is modest.

Future trends to watch for include:

  • Changes in global cotton prices that could impact import costs.
  • Shifts in consumer preferences towards sustainable and ethical fashion.
  • Geopolitical factors that might affect trade policies and tariffs.
  • Technological advancements in textile manufacturing.
